Commission grants retroactive approval for landing and rear deck at 915 Taylor St.
Summary
Albany's Planning and Zoning Commission approved a use permit and design review application for 915 Taylor Street on Feb. 12, allowing a 39‑square‑foot exterior landing and stairs (nonconforming 6‑ft front setback) and retroactively approving an approximately 300‑sq. ft. rear deck. The vote was 4–0.
The City of Albany Planning and Zoning Commission on Feb. 12 approved a use permit and design review for 915 Taylor Street that authorizes a 39‑square‑foot exterior landing with stairs at the lower‑unit entrance and retroactive design review for an approximately 300‑square‑foot rear deck.
